About this Service
I enjoy supervising within a gestalt-integrative framework and bring a relational, creative and embodied approach. I have many years experience of supervising trainees, accredited practitioners and experienced practitioners from diverse modalities. I work with individuals, dyads and groups. I like to work collaboratively and compassionately, paying attention to head, heart and soul. My experience as a trainer can be particularly useful to trainees and trainers.

Qualifications
I am an experienced UKCP-registered psychotherapist, supervisor and trainer, working within a relational embodied approach and influenced by shamanism and buddhism. I have been involved in gestalt for over 20 years. For around ten years, until 2017, I was a member of the Edinburgh Gestalt Institute training faculty and excutive team, leaving to further my professional interests including writing. Previously, I worked in the addictions and mental health fields.
